    I have an ASUS ROG Strix Scar 16 laptop. I usually set my icon spacing to a value of -2200

    Computer\H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Control Panel\Desktop\WindowMetrics

    Every reboot, that value resets to -1200, so the icons are squished next to each other and the text is truncated.

    I initially thought it might be due to one of the built-in utilities that handles multi monitors, GlideX and ScreenXpert, but even after uninstalling them, that didn't fix the issue.

    What else might be causing this? I never had this problem before, must be something with those ASUS utilities but I can't for the life of me figure it out
